May is here, so let’s check the MacBook Neo inventory for the new month. In April, Apple sold out of its online inventory for the month after just 15 days. For the month of May, Apple is starting the month with MacBook Neo shipping estimates ranging from May 18th to May 26th.
Apple doesn’t seem to be catching up with MacBook Neo demand anytime soon
The quickest way to buy a MacBook Neo from Apple is to take advantage of in-store stock. As delivery dates continue to move back daily, in-store pickup options change throughout the month.
Meanwhile, Amazon is shaving $10 off the $599 price and offering select styles, including citrus, indigo, and blush styles, arriving as early as May 3. Other models are promised for around the middle of the month.
Walmart seems to be the best place to find silver MacBook Neo inventory with next-day delivery options.
Apple revealed the MacBook Neo on March 4, opening pre-orders shortly after the announcement. The MacBook Neo arrived in stores a week later, on March 11.
Launch inventory quickly sold out, and Apple hasn’t caught up with demand since. The MacBook Neo comes in four colors (silver, blush, citrus, and indigo) and two configurations (256GB or 512GB with Touch ID).

Apple CEO Tim Cook said the Mac “had its best launch week ever for new Mac customers” following the arrival of the MacBook Neo. Cook said customer response to the Neo was “just off the charts” during yesterday’s earnings call.
